Central Coast Chaos (2001)

This little video has taken three years to get here. Newsense skateboards was Kory Kroll and Kris Kroll's Los Osos based skate company. They made boards, shirts, stickers, and videos. Central Coast Chaos was their first video effort, filled with lo-fi tape deck editing. The formats were all completely different from camera to camera so it's a miracle this thing even got done. Probably the trick with the most hype was Mike Salmon's Slo High 17 stair attempt. Gotta love the basketball shorts! After this video it seemed like everyone in Los Osos and Morro Bay had a Newsense board and were laughing at the pink man on the unicycle. As time went on though, the videos slowly disappeared. I thought I had the last existing copy until I lent it out and it got ate up by a VCR. With the help of Kory Kroll (who didn't have the video himself) we tracked down what I believe is the absolute last copy. The video was an ultimate inspiration for the 14 year old me who couldn't comprehend how they edited it themselves. It's taken a long time to get here, but it was well worth it.

Dredge the Lethe - Laguna Ledge

Taking a look back at the chunkiest ledges in Slo.


Sadly enough, the first time I ever heard of a pro skating a spot in slo was this Brian Sumner ad for hair products. Despite the product placement and the choppy sequence, I was pretty excited to see Laguna in print. From Skateboarder Magazine, November 2003




For years I waited for the footage to turn up in a video but it never made it. That was until, classic clips made a Brian Sumner part.




With the help of Michael Mull, I saw the Sumner clips and some amazing Mark Appleyard footage that never made it to video. How did a tre flip noseslide not get a proper showing?




Nick Walters grind up Laguna was absolutely ridiculous, but he was not the first person to go up it. A now forgotten Stacy Lowry had a fs noseslide up it back in 2005.




The now defunct 411 put out a Stereo issue in 2004 which covered a tour from LA to SF. The Stereo guys made a stop in Slo to shoot a commercial and skate some spots. Keep an eye out for the Benny Fairfax nollie at Madonna center and the Clint Peterson fs board at Denny's.

Nerd Out - FTC Edition

When mentioning Brendan Leddy and tricks in videos, I began to think of another SLO skater...


In Daniel Parks recent part for The Jazzpush Video, we threw in some old SF footage for the intro. One trick that stood out was his backside five-0 to frontside 180 out at Brown Marble.



I recently watched "Finally" by FTC, and noticed Scott Johnston had the same trick in his part.

.


So does Greg Hunt in "A Visual Sound" by Stereo.




Daniel does a nollie inward heel at Miley in the beginning of "Dig This".




Chico Brenes gets the same trick in "Finally".


That's it for today. If you haven't seen "Finally" or "A Visual Sound" I recommend you look them up. I'm planning on covering some rarely seen Laguna Ledge clips for next week.

The Jazzpush Video - Montage

All the non full parts but just as satisfying as one. Cody and Tristan have been around for a while now, with little footage to show over the last ten years. It's not their fault, they've always been skating for the right reasons, but in a small area like Slo, the camera is not always there. This site is a homage to Slo county skateboarding, the small fish in the small pond, and I feel someone needs to recognize it. That's why I had a great time filming them especially. Cody has been skating Baywood for the better part of twenty years now.

Then there are the younger guys like Jade who are tough to get in front of a lens. You know he's good, but he's either filming or doesn't want to be filmed. If you have the DVD, you can at least get a better glimpse in the bonus section, or just watch him in person. Jade's footage was a huge contribution to the video so either way, he was a great help. Berkeley was a late addition to the video and probably could of had a full part if we were filming a couple months prior. All the footage of Berkeley was in the span of about four different sessions. Look at his clothes, he's wearing the same thing in most of it.

Brendan was another who joined late in the project and I was super excited about it because of his natural skill. His short ends part is unbelievable, and for him, this is just something he does whenever he goes and skates. Isn't that the point though? Just going out and skating with friends?
